At its simplest, insolvency indicates that an organization (or private) does not have enough possessions to cover its financial debts and can not pay its financial obligations when they come to be due, and when that happens it is time to do something about it.


With this treatment, a Licensed Bankruptcy Professional is designated to be the Liquidator. They are mandated by regulation to sell off and close the insolvent firm down and produce the best possible value for the financially troubled business's lenders prior to winding up the company. The price of an insolvency expert differs based on elements such as the intricacy of the situation, the amount of debt, and the sort of being gone after. Complex instances including several stakeholders and intricate economic plans often call for more time and knowledge, hence causing higher charges for the bankruptcy professional. This includes the intricacy of assets and the degree of engagement from creditors. In cases where liquidations include complex possessions and extensive creditor engagement, experts may bill greater hourly prices due to the boosted workload and experience called for. Additionally, the existence of substantial individual funds or safeguarded creditors can affect the threat and complexity of the insolvency process, which can also affect the practitioners'charge framework. Bigger debt volumes usually entail a lot more considerable and time-consuming procedures, affecting the general expense for the solutions provided.
